Term glossopharyngeal nerve development ID (Ontology) GO:0021563 (Gene Ontology)
Definition Various sensory and motor branches of the glossopharyngeal nerve supply nerve connections to the pharynx and back of the tongue. The branchial motor component contains motor fibers that innervate muscles that elevate the pharynx and larynx, and the tympanic branch supplies parasympathetic fibers to the otic ganglion.[ ISBN:0838580343 ]
Also Known As "cranial nerve 9 development" ; "cranial nerve IX development"
